WWE has announced a pair of things for this Monday’s edition of Raw. The first is a handicap match while the second will see the return of the Firefly Funhouse.
Randy Orton will attempt to find his way to the Firefly Funhouse this Monday after The Fiend has continued to stalk him in recent weeks. Meanwhile, WWE Champion Drew McIntyre and Sheamus will take on The Miz, John Morrison and AJ Styles in a three-on-two handicap match.

Here is the official preview for Randy Orton’s trip to the Firefly Funhouse from WWE.com:
“The voices in Randy Orton’s head are telling him to step inside the Firefly Fun House.
The Viper plans to do just that this Monday on Rawas his psychological war with Bray Wyatt and Alexa Bliss gets taken to a whole new level. After an intense moment this past Monday on “A Moment of Bliss” that culminated in a standoff between Orton and The Fiend, there’s no telling how the mind games will continue to escalate on Wyatt’s turf.
What will happen when Orton invites himself to the Firefly Fun House with a clash against The Fiend at WWE TLC on the horizon?”
This week’s episode of Raw shall continue the build towards the WWE TLC pay per view. Currently, Drew McIntyre vs. AJ Styles for the WWE Championship is the only confirmed match for the show.
